PIA nextgen portforward (#242)
* Split provider/pia.go in piav3.go and piav4.go * Change port forwarding signature * Enable port forwarding parameter for PIA v4 * Fix VPN gateway IP obtention * Setup HTTP client for TLS with custom cert * Error message for regions not supporting pf
